A new playground is being built on Asbury Park’s Second Avenue beach to replace one that was destroyed by Hurricane Sandy. Two separate units meant for different age groups will make up the entire playground area, which “is similar to what was there previously,” according to city engineer Joe Cunha. Two shooting incidents took place in Asbury Park over the weekend. On Saturday at approximately 7 p.m., a 20 year old male suffered a non-life-threatening gunshot wound in the area of Emory Street, according to Charles Webster, public information officer at the Monmouth County Prosecutor’s office. Children involved in the summer program at the Boys & Girls Club in Asbury Park helped kick off a community art initiative on Monday. The project, called “Table Talk,” is designed to create spaces for people to meet and engage in civic discourse around handmade tables placed in specific locations around the community.
